Output 626daa301433887f284be0275a272e330c626707064dc50711fa294cfd55920a:1

value
58385534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9812d3dd759a043a550ed21d6204c044b73a519 OP_EQUALVERIFY OP_CHECKSIG
address
1PkG185JFsej8GBj8SUj6hznq2XWB1JXqL
transaction
626daa301433887f284be0275a272e330c626707064dc50711fa294cfd55920a
spent
true